Как добавить видео-фон в качестве баннера на мой сайт в Laravel? - PullRequest
0 голосов
/ 08 июля 2019

Все, что я пытаюсь сделать, - это иметь фоновое изображение в виде баннера, а поверх видео иметь свой логотип и панель навигации (но прозрачную).

Я пробовал много кода,но в какой-то момент меня блокируют в файлах scss.Мое видео отображается слишком большим по ширине, и из-за этого у меня появляется полоса прокрутки внизу страницы.Мне нужно, чтобы ширина была 1200px, но в итоге она просто не работает.

Я использую scss и я новичок.Если у вас есть какие-то решения, пожалуйста, дайте мне знать.Нужно ли мне компилировать sass / scss в проекте Laravel?Потому что я установил файлы узлов для sass в проекте Laravel и все должно иметь sass для работы.

Мой HTML-код:

<div class="banner"> <video autoplay muted loop> <source src="img/banner.mp4" type="video/mp4"> </video> </div>

Пожалуйста, ядействительно мог бы здесь помочь.

Спасибо!

1 Ответ

0 голосов
/ 08 июля 2019

Из вашего вопроса я понимаю, что вы не получаете файл .scss в laravel.Дело в том, что SASS не понятен браузерам напрямую.Вам нужно скомпилировать его, чтобы браузеры могли его показать.Вам нужно будет заставить файл .css работать.

Ваше краткосрочное исправление - использование конвертера sass в css.Вы можете найти много услуг в Интернете.Затем вы можете напрямую использовать файлы css.

Однако, если вы часто используете SASS или любой другой подобный язык стилей препроцессора, вам следует настроить среду разработки laravel.Для этого вы можете выполнить следующие шаги.

Прежде всего, возьмите все файлы Sass в вашей папке.Предпочтительно /resources/assets/sass.Затем скомпилируйте его, используя gulp.Также вы можете использовать смесь Laravel.После этого попробуйте запустить npm run watch.Если вы еще не установили npm, вам нужно будет установить его.

Следует скомпилировать SASS.Вы должны получить файл CSS в вашей папке /public.Скорее всего, /public/css папка.

Пожалуйста, проверьте laravel mix для получения дополнительной информации о смеси laravel.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...